haploids are better for mutation studies because in them all the mutations whether recessive or dominant are expressed as_______________?
Correct answer: C. There is only one alleles of each gene present in each cell

Explanation
A haploid cell has only one allele of each gene, so a mutation cannot be hidden by a second normal allele and is expressed whether it would be called dominant or recessive in a diploid. Thus option c supplies the reason haploids are useful in mutation studies.
